  • Windows 7 Phone is not the continuation of Windows Mobile. It’s totally brand new platform similar to Zune HD (that we don’t have it here).  It will have all modern smartphone common features and function, such as huge screen with multitouch, deep integration with social networking, closely interact with cloud apps, apps as valued added for the phone, focus on rich and multimedia content and etc. Hardware and software will be closely integrated so the smartphone can run on it utmost performance.
  • No UI (user interface) customization allowed on Windows Phone 7 Series. So forget the likes of HTC Sense. All phones will have similar looks and feels regardless of the phone manufacturers.
  • No copy and paste feature as confirmed by Microsoft , although another article pointing out the feature will be available as upgrade once the phone release to the market
  • Brand new Windows Phone Marketplace – Haven’t seen or use the old one, but reading the review, that it is going to be good one.
  • Windows Phone Marketplace is also going to be the only source of application for Windows Phone 7 Series, sort of Apple iTunes. However, Microsoft do provide an exception to large enterprise who want to deployed their own application directly to the device, the detail will be unveiled later.
  • No Multitasking – No actual multitasking in the sense that you familiar with. Built-in apps can run on background, but not third party apps. But this third party apps that cannot run on background is not totally killed, should called it “half backgrounded”.
  • Games is one of the key feature in Windows Phone 7 Series, so it is expexted that Microsoft will bring XBox 360 games into this phone. The games can be played on cross platform device ranging from phone, PC and Xbox. For instance, if you stop the games at one point at phone, you can resume the games at the same point in XBox. Cool huh? The development for cross platform games also has been simplified with introduction of XNA Studio 5.

TM’s HSBB Retail Service Launch Includes HSBB Showcase, Exhibition and Entertainment

In accordance with HSBB retail service launch event next Wednesday 24th March,  TM is inviteing public to witness  the historical event which will be held at Dataran Merdeka, Kuala Lumpur. Beside the launch event, TM will prepare HSBB showcase and interactive exhibition at the same venue, that feature rich multimedia application and entertainment , interactive games and IPTV. The showcase and exhibition is open to public, from 7.00 PM onward until the next day evening.

There is also open air concert by popular local artist leading up to the official launch that evening. Entertainment and activity such as games, contest and lucky draw are also being planned to draw more crowd to this event. Menara TM will be lit with graphical countdown projection beam depicting the number ’1′ of 1 Malaysia on every evening starting yesterday 18 March, to mark the countdown to 24March 2010.

The Prime Minister YAB Dato’ Seri Najib Tun Razak will launch both the National Broadband Implementation (NBI) initiative and TM’s next-generation HSBB service.
